注意事项与最佳实践 异步编程理解: 深入理解异步编程模型对于处理网络I/O和回调至关重要。
这不仅可以避免列名冲突,还能提高代码的可读性,并使得后续通过 CTE.c.alias_name 访问列更加直观。
可选地根据文件类型设置 Content-Type 提升兼容性。
答案:C++中推荐使用std::this_thread::sleep_for实现延迟,跨平台且精度高;Windows可用Sleep(),Linux可用usleep()(已弃用);避免空循环延迟。
子主题: 强烈建议使用子主题进行修改,这样可以避免在主题更新时丢失你的自定义代码。
可以考虑将 JavaScript 代码放在单独的文件中,然后通过 PHP 动态生成链接。
常用的方法包括使用标准库中的set或unordered_set去重,或者结合vector与算法函数实现。
当它看到@result_property装饰了prop方法,而prop方法的返回类型是int时,它会推断出result_property实例的泛型参数T为int。
总结 CGo为Go与C的互操作提供了强大的能力,但其设计哲学是确保安全和可靠性。
下面介绍如何将PHP框架(以Laravel或ThinkPHP为例)与Vue/React整合。
内存占用与缓存友好性 vector内存紧凑,每个元素额外开销小,缓存命中率高,适合频繁遍历的场景。
然而,当用户输入错误密码时,WordPress仍然会尝试设置一个 wp-postpass_ cookie(尽管其内容无效),这使得 !isset($cookie) 的判断结果为 false,从而导致导航在用户未成功验证时仍然显示,或者在用户预期它隐藏时却因为cookie的存在而显示。
解决方案 数据分组的实现,通常围绕着一个核心循环展开:遍历原始数据集合,对于每一个数据项,确定它应该属于哪个组,然后将这个数据项添加到对应组的容器中。
STL定义五类迭代器:输入、输出、前向、双向和随机访问迭代器,功能由弱到强。
虽然它是一个全栈框架,但其API功能也非常强大,通过Passport或Sanctum可以轻松实现认证。
char str[] = "example"; char* p = str; cout << p[0]; // 输出 'e' cout << *(p + 1); // 输出 'x' 这种灵活性允许在函数中传递指针,并使用下标进行遍历,提高代码可读性。
可启用批量验证batch()以收集所有错误,getError()返回错误数组,便于前端统一提示。
以下是一个使用 time.Sleep() 的示例:package main import ( "fmt" "time" ) func worker(id int) { for { fmt.Printf("Worker %d: Doing some work...\n", id) time.Sleep(time.Second * 5) // 休眠 5 秒 } } func main() { for i := 1; i <= 3; i++ { go worker(i) } time.Sleep(time.Minute * 1) // 主 Goroutine 休眠 1 分钟,让 worker Goroutine 运行 }在这个例子中,worker Goroutine 会每隔 5 秒打印一条消息。
然而,在处理如级联下拉菜单这类场景时,如果不加优化,每次用户选择都可能触发对服务器的重复数据请求,即使这些数据之前已经获取过。
答案是防止SQL注入需使用参数化查询,JWT可用于无状态认证,忘记密码需通过令牌机制安全重置。
本文链接:http://www.arcaderelics.com/61398_1708b1.html